Overview
- Kay told Radio 2 listeners he puts BBC Radio 5 Live, the BBC’s news and sport station, on at the weekend, then joked “for legal reasons” he had to say he likes his job.
- He singled out Match of the Day host Mark Chapman as a “great” and “tremendous” broadcaster while describing his Saturday routine.
- Moments later he tried to undo the remark, saying he had not thought it through and had talked himself into “a cul-de-sac.”
- National and regional outlets reported the exchange as an awkward, light moment with no sign of formal action from the BBC.
- The flap follows past minor bits on his show, including a listener’s complaint about his blackhead chat and a playful “I just got fired” line at Radio 2 in the Park.
